"Allah Janta Hai Mohammad Ka Martaba" is one of the most revered and spiritually uplifting naats (poetry in praise of the Prophet Muhammad) in the Islamic world. For decades, it has touched the hearts of millions of believers globally. The powerful lyrics highlight a fundamental theological truth in Islam: while humanity can appreciate the blessings brought by the Prophet Muhammad, only Almighty Allah truly comprehends the full extent of his sublime status and spiritual grandeur. allah janta hai mohammad ka martaba lyrics top
